Hi Arkesh, To update permission settings on IIS, simply right click on a virtual directory (e.g. GoogleAppsSso). Under the "Virtual Directory" tab, you can update permissions like Read, Write, Script source access, etc.
For more info about IIS permission, please take a look at the following article http://support.microsoft.com/kb/313075.
